Ryzen 5 5600X – Best CPU for RTX 2070 Super Overall

The Ryzen 5 5600X is the cleanest pairing for the RTX 2070 Super. Its Zen 3 architecture delivers single-thread performance that keeps the GPU fully occupied at both 1080p and 1440p, and the six-core design handles background load and light streaming alongside gaming. The X-suffix variant clocks slightly higher than the standard 5600 out of the box, which is useful for competitive titles where frame rate consistency matters most. This CPU does not need a high-end cooler to stay within its thermal limits, making it a straightforward drop-in for most AM4 builds.

The 5600X is unlocked for overclocking, supports PCIe 4.0 on select 500-series motherboards, and runs on the mature AM4 platform. This means you can pair it with a B550 board for a reasonable total cost. The six cores and twelve threads are exactly what the RTX 2070 Super needs; adding more cores does not improve gaming performance at this GPU tier.

One honest limitation of the Ryzen 5 5600X is that it does not support PCIe 5.0, which newer GPUs and SSDs may eventually use. If you plan to keep this CPU for several years and upgrade to a future graphics card, you might miss out on that bandwidth advantage. Additionally, the 5600X is often priced close to the 5600 non-X, so you should check current pricing to see if the small clock bump is worth it for your specific use case.

Core i5-12600K – Best Intel CPU for RTX 2070 Super

The i5-12600K uses Intel’s hybrid core architecture with six performance cores and four efficiency cores, delivering strong single-thread output alongside capable multitasking. For a 1440p gaming rig built around the RTX 2070 Super, it provides headroom to spare and never becomes the limiting factor. The unlocked multiplier allows overclocking on Z690 or Z790 boards for those who want the maximum possible performance from their CPU. The efficiency cores handle background tasks like streaming encoding or file downloads without interfering with the game’s performance cores.

The 12600K supports both DDR4 and DDR5 memory, giving you flexibility in your build budget. It also supports PCIe 5.0 for the GPU and NVMe drives, future-proofing your system for next-generation components. The hybrid design means Windows 11 is recommended to properly schedule threads across the performance and efficiency cores.

One honest limitation of the Core i5-12600K is its higher power draw and heat output compared to the AMD alternatives. You will need a capable aftermarket cooler, and a Z-series motherboard is recommended to unlock overclocking and fully utilize the hybrid architecture. This raises the total platform cost. Additionally, the efficiency cores do not significantly help gaming performance today, so you are paying for multitasking capability that may go unused if you only game.

Ryzen 7 5700X – Best Future-Proof CPU for RTX 2070 Super

The Ryzen 7 5700X steps up to eight cores and sixteen threads on the same Zen 3 architecture, making it an excellent choice if a GPU upgrade is planned within the next year. The additional cores do not meaningfully help the RTX 2070 Super beyond what six cores provide, but they ensure the CPU remains a non-bottleneck when a more powerful GPU replaces the 2070 Super. It runs cooler than the 5800X while offering the same core count, which means you can use a modest air cooler and still maintain low noise levels.

It has a 65-watt TDP, which is remarkably efficient for an eight-core processor. This makes it a strong candidate for compact builds where thermal management is a priority. The extra threads also help in productivity tasks like video editing or 3D rendering, if you use your gaming PC for work as well.

One honest limitation of the Ryzen 7 5700X is that the extra cores are wasted on the RTX 2070 Super in pure gaming scenarios. You are paying for future headroom that you may not use for a year or more. Additionally, the AM4 platform is a dead end for CPU upgrades beyond the 5000 series, so if you want to upgrade to a newer architecture later, you will need a new motherboard anyway.

Core i5-12400F – Best Budget Intel CPU for RTX 2070 Super

The i5-12400F punches well above its price class with six performance cores and hyperthreading delivering 12th-gen Intel IPC at a moderate cost. For a 1440p build centered on the RTX 2070 Super, it fully unlocks the GPU in the vast majority of games without requiring a premium Z-series motherboard. B660 and B760 boards keep the platform affordable. The F-suffix means no integrated graphics, which is fine since you have a dedicated GPU, and it saves you money compared to the non-F version.

It does not support overclocking, but the stock performance is already strong enough for the RTX 2070 Super.

One honest limitation of the Core i5-12400F is that its 4.4 GHz turbo frequency is lower than the 12600K and 5600X, which can show a small frame rate gap in very CPU-intensive games at 1080p. Additionally, the lack of efficiency cores means multitasking is less smooth than the 12600K if you run heavy background applications. For pure gaming on a budget, however, this is a minor trade-off.

Ryzen 5 5600 – Best Value AMD CPU for RTX 2070 Super

The standard Ryzen 5 5600 delivers near-identical gaming performance to the 5600X at a lower price point, making it the default recommendation for budget-focused RTX 2070 Super builds on AM4. The difference in clock speed between the two models does not produce a meaningful frame rate gap in real games. For anyone building on a tight budget who wants AMD platform longevity and Zen 3 efficiency, this is the smart pick. It also runs cooler than the 5600X, so you can use the stock cooler or a cheap aftermarket unit.

What to look for

  • Single-thread performance: The RTX 2070 Super is mid-range, so a CPU with high IPC and boost clocks prevents bottlenecks at 1080p and 1440p.
  • Core count and threads: Six cores is the sweet spot for this GPU; eight cores only matter if you plan to upgrade the GPU soon or do productivity work.
  • Platform cost: Factor in motherboard, cooler, and RAM costs. A cheaper CPU that requires an expensive board can ruin the value.
  • PCIe generation support: PCIe 4.0 is fine for the RTX 2070 Super, but PCIe 5.0 offers future-proofing for next-gen GPUs and SSDs.
  • Power efficiency and cooling: A CPU that runs cool lets you use a quieter, cheaper cooler and keeps system temperatures lower.
  • Overclocking support: Unlocked CPUs allow extra performance headroom, but require a compatible motherboard and adequate cooling.
  • Memory compatibility: Some CPUs support both DDR4 and DDR5; choose based on your budget and performance needs.

What CPUs bottleneck the RTX 2070 Super at 1080p?

Older quad-core chips without hyperthreading, such as the i5-7600K or Ryzen 5 1600, can bottleneck the RTX 2070 Super in CPU-limited titles at 1080p. The GPU pushes frame rates high enough that a slow CPU becomes the limiting factor. A modern 6-core processor with strong single-thread performance eliminates this issue in the vast majority of games.

Is the RTX 2070 Super still a good GPU in 2026?

The RTX 2070 Super handles 1440p gaming at high settings in most titles and remains a capable mid-range card in 2026. It lacks ray tracing performance of newer generations but delivers excellent rasterization output. Pairing it with a strong modern CPU extends its relevance without requiring a GPU upgrade for another year or two in most gaming scenarios.

Does the RTX 2070 Super benefit from PCIe 4.0?

No meaningful gaming benefit comes from PCIe 4.0 for the RTX 2070 Super. The card is a PCIe 3.0 GPU and does not saturate PCIe 3.0 bandwidth in any gaming workload. Running it on a PCIe 4.0 platform is fine, but selecting a platform solely for PCIe 4.0 bandwidth provides no measurable frame rate improvement with this GPU.
